Ford in lead for in-car healthcare

By Joe Jancsurak, Editor

Ford, Microsoft, Healthrageous, and BlueMetal Architects announced earlier this month an alliance to develop technologies for the mobile health and wellness monitoring/maintenance. The alliance was unveiled during the “Doctor in Your Car” keynote address at the Digital Health Summit at the International CES in Las Vegas.

The announcement comes just seven months after Ford held a media event at its Dearborn headquarters to trumpet collaborative efforts with Medtronic (continuous glucose monitoring system), SDI Health (informational asthma and allergy system, and WellDoc (mobile health integrated services). For more on the May announcement, click "Coming soon: Cars that care about your health."

“People are spending more time in their cars, and with the tremendous growth in mobile healthcare solutions, Ford is dedicated to understanding the value of being able to connect to health and wellness-related services while driving,” said Gary Strumolo, manager of Infotainment, Interiors, Health and Wellness at Ford Research and Innovation. “Our connectivity platform – Ford SYNC – provides easy, voice-controlled access to mobile devices such as smartphones and tablets, and therefore it makes sense to research areas that are important to our customers.”

NSF-DBA adds device training via Pink acquisition


NSF-DBA, an Ann Arbor, MI-based company that provides training and consulting for the pharmaceutical industry, has acquired UK-based medical device training and consulting company Pink Associates.Pink consults include planning clinical trials, developing product and process validation strategies, conducting training and academic research, and performing technical and quality management system audits to ensure manufacturers meet international medical device regulations.

MagnaCare, Telcare team up for diabetes care


MagnaCare, a New York-based health plan management company, announced its partnership with Bethesda, MD-based Telcare, maker of the BGM wireless-enabled blood glucose meter. The Telcare BGM automatically transmits readings to an FDA-cleared, privacy-secured online database that can be accessed via web browser or smartphone apps by patients, physicians, caregivers or family members, as authorized by the patient. The device transmits real-time access to readings, provides feedback, and enables physicians and caregivers to intervene when blood glucose levels reach dangerous levels.

DSM joins EU-funded consortium to advance treatment of ocular diseases



DSM, a leading biomedical materials company, announced that it is contributing proprietary knowledge in the preparation of tailored amino acid-based polymers and offering use of processing facilities that will produce an innovative step change in the sustained delivery of drug molecules. The PANOPTES consortium’s goal is to research and develop novel drug delivery technology for the posterior eye segment. This partnership further validates the innovative properties of DSM’s polyesteramide (PEA) biomaterials as a superior drug-delivery technology.

Powerful feedback


The introduction of Balluff’s IP67 intelligent power supplies with Heartbeat technology by Balluff allows maintenance crews to get reliable feedback on the real-time and long-term status of the supply and to be able to predict the replacement and maintenance cycle of the supply. Such feedback is unusual as most power supplies for industrial use do not provide feedback on their long-term health. A faulty or dying power supply can cause maintenance crews hours of production time in troubleshooting and repair.

Illuminator module comes complete with electronics and communication interfaces


The XLM Plus LED fiber optic illuminator module with electronics by Excelitas Technologies is suited for endoscopy, surgical microscopy, and surgical headlamp applications. The product provides light output that is comparable to 180 W Xenon sources, yet with the advantages of LED lighting, which include long life, less heat output, and virtually no ultraviolet or infrared radiation, which eliminates the need for filtering. The XLM Plus LED Light Module is compliant with medical safety standards IEC/EN 60601-1 and EN 60601-1-2, and it includes integrated electronic circuitry for safety alarms, error mode and power status indicators. It provides circuitry for connection to fiber safety interlocks, and it can be immediately shut off for vision protection in the event a fiber is removed from the illuminator during use.

Expanded catalog details brushless DC and intelligent servo motors


Medical equipment and laboratory automation motor manufacturer, Dunkermotor, has released its 2012 catalog of low voltage brushless DC and intelligent servo motors. The catalog includes detailed specifications on custom configurable BLDC motors, controls, gearheads, brakes, encoders and accessories and is now available for download at the Dunkermotor website or by email request for hard copies. The product line is based on five frame sizes of high power density low voltage BLDC motors, ranging from 32 to 75 mm (1.26 to 2.95 inches) with continuous output power ratings up to 530 W (0.7 hp). They are available as motors only or can be configured in infinite varieties with separate or integral controls, incremental or absolute encoders, matched parallel shaft and right angle gearing, as well as power-off or power-on brakes.
